Hey everyone, my PC has just started acting really slow out of nowhere. My loading times increased by a factor of 10, and my download speeds plummeted from 20-35 Mbps down to only 250 Kbps. It doesn't seem like there's a resource issue, as everything looks normal on that front. I haven't downloaded anything new lately, so I'm pretty sure it's not a virus. Any thoughts on what could be causing this?

Have you tried rebooting your PC? Sometimes a simple restart can resolve hidden issues. Also, check if there are any pending Windows updates that need to be installed. Occasionally, those can impact performance as well.
It sounds like it could be a storage issue, especially if you notice slow loading times and download issues. Check your drive’s SMART status to see if there's any indication of problems. Also, make sure there’s enough free space on your SSD because low available storage can significantly affect performance.
If your internet is acting up, don't forget to power cycle your modem and router. That’s a common fix when you see slow internet speeds. It's good that you restarted your PC already, but rebooting your network equipment might help.
